Stainless steel is the industry standard, but not all stainless steel is created equal. The two most common grades you'll encounter are SS304 and SS316 - and understanding their differences is essential for making informed configuration decisions.
SS304 (18/8 Stainless Steel) is the most widely used austenitic stainless steel in the world. Its name comes from its typical composition: approximately 18% chromium and 8% nickel. This combination provides excellent corrosion resistance for most indoor and general industrial applications. SS304 is non-magnetic (in annealed condition), has good formability, and offers a balance of strength and ductility that makes it suitable for a wide range of sterilizer applications [1].
SS316 (Marine Grade Stainless Steel) builds on the 304 formula by adding 2-3% molybdenum. This single addition dramatically improves resistance to chlorides and industrial solvents. The molybdenum content is what makes 316 the preferred choice for marine environments, coastal facilities, medical implants, and chemical processing equipment. Like 304, it's austenitic and non-magnetic, but with enhanced corrosion resistance and slightly higher mechanical strength [2].
SS304 vs SS316: Technical Specification Comparison
| Property | SS304 (18/8 Steel) | SS316 (Marine Grade) | Practical Impact |
|---|---|---|---|
| Chromium Content | 18-20% | 16-18% | Both provide excellent oxidation resistance |
| Nickel Content | 8-10.5% | 10-14% | 316 has better toughness at low temperatures |
| Molybdenum | 0% | 2-3% | 316 resists chlorides and acids significantly better |
| Tensile Strength | 515 MPa (75 ksi) | 579 MPa (84 ksi) | 316 is approximately 12% stronger |
| Yield Strength | 205 MPa (30 ksi) | 290 MPa (42 ksi) | 316 resists deformation better under load |
| Elongation | 40% | 40% | Both have excellent formability |
| Relative Cost | Baseline (100%) | 120-140% of 304 | 316 costs 20-40% more [4] |
| Corrosion Resistance | Excellent for indoor use | Superior for marine and chemical | 316 mandatory for saltwater exposure |
The cost difference between these grades is significant and directly impacts your pricing strategy on Alibaba.com. Industry sources consistently report that SS316 costs 20-40% more than SS304, with variations depending on market conditions, thickness, and finish [4]. For a typical laboratory sterilizer chamber, this can translate to a 150-400 USD difference in material costs alone. Understanding whether your target buyers need (and will pay for) 316's enhanced performance is crucial for competitive positioning.
